Monetary Benefits

The OKP Scholarship offers a life-changing opportunity for international students pursuing MS degree programs or short courses at Netherlands Universities. The scholarship covers crucial expenses, including:

  • Insurance
  • Travel and Visa Fees
  • Full Tuition

Please note, that while the OKP scholarship covers a significant portion of expenses, any remaining costs would be the student’s responsibility. Initiated by the Dutch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the OKP program ensures full financial support. This enables international students to study in the Netherlands without financial constraints.

Qualifications for the Dutch Government Scholarship

To be eligible for the OKP Netherlands Government Scholarship, applicants should fulfill the following general criteria:

  • Possess relevant job experience.
  • Belong to the listed eligible countries.
  • Hold a government-issued photo ID.
  • Admission into the chosen academic program
  • Proficient in English or French
  • Consent to the most recent terms and requirements.
